A Celebration of Life will be held on Saturday, December 20, 2025, at 11:00 AM at Our Savior's Church – Broussard Campus, located at 655 Highway 96, Broussard, LA, for Derek Albert, age 39, who passed away on December 6, 2025.

The family request that visitation be observed at Our Savior's Church - Broussard Campus on Saturday at 9:00am until time of services.

Pastor Hannaniah Owens will officiate the services.

Born in New Iberia on August 10, 1986, Derek James Albert grew up attending New Iberia Senior High School and was the only son of John and Julie Bourgeois. He was a loving father, son, brother, uncle, and friend—basically everyone’s favorite person to call when something needed fixing.

He had a gift for compassion and warmth, making others feel seen, valued, and cared for. Derek’s kindness was quiet but deeply felt; he never hesitated to help a friend, offer a smile, or share a moment of joy. He was a kind, gentle, and loving soul whose presence brought comfort—and the promise of laughter that could brighten even the darkest day. He will be remembered for his generous heart, the deep love he had for his sons and family including his loyal “#1 homie,” his dog Jonah, and a sense of humor that could get him out of most situations he probably got himself into.

Derek is survived by his loving parents, John and Julie Bourgeois; children, Rylin Padgett, Griffin and Legend Albert; siblings, Christine Funk (Kelly) and Kassi Bourgeois; nieces Violet and Scarlett Young, Amelia and Kennedy Funk. He also leaves behind special family members Brooklyn Belanger, Tony Walters, Alayah and Mason Gary and Zae Romero.

Derek is preceded in death by his grandmother Patricia Hebert, grandfather Willard Bourgeois (Pop), grandmother Sharon Albert, and uncles Jimmy Bourgeois and Dwight Bonin.

Derek immeasurably touched the lives of everyone fortunate enough to know him. Though life feels forever changed without him, the love he shared remains with us—steadfast, unforgettable, and eternal. May Derek rest in peace and may his legacy of kindness continue to guide us.
